Drupal 7处理多个字段(> 40)的最佳方式是什么。 我要处理旅馆的内容类型。 D7创建了与字段数一样多的mysql表,所以我担心这些表演,但也许这不是问题。
我是否必须创建实体和子实体或创建模块以将某些数据存储在同一个表中(设备字段,服务字段,活动字段等) 或其他解决方案?
非常感谢您的建议!
答案 0 :(得分:1)
40个字段并没有那么糟糕,因为我看起来有很多字段的数据库表。
Drupal在OO和规范化方面并不是那么好,但你可以:
希望有所帮助
答案 1 :(得分:1)
你可以保持原样,因为,你知道,在性能和灵活性之间,Drupal选择了灵活性:)
如果你想将所有这些存储在1个表中,可以编写实现自定义字段集的模块,如下所示:http://www.lullabot.com/articles/creating-custom-cck-fields 然而,它是针对D6的 - 我没有为D7做过与核心中的cck字段相似的事情,所以不能在这里给你指路。